What if a single unnoticed outage cost you loyal users and revenue? That question matters because research shows over 9% of visitors won’t come back after encountering downtime or errors.
You need clear visibility into your infrastructure so your team can act fast. Modern monitoring platforms combine synthetic monitoring with real user tracking to catch problems across global locations.
Pick a monitoring tool that tracks SSL certificate status and domain expiry to avoid embarrassing, preventable incidents. Good solutions also offer customizable status pages, reliable sms alerts, and ways to reduce false positives so your team stays focused.
In this guide, we analyze plans, pricing, API integrations, and transaction checks to help you protect performance and keep users satisfied.
Key Takeaways
- Act before users notice: proactive alerts prevent churn.
- Combine synthetic and real user data for full visibility.
- Track ssl certificate and domain expiry to avoid outages.
- Choose platforms that minimize false positives and offer status pages.
- Consider pricing, integrations, and transaction checks for critical paths.
Why Website Reliability Matters for Your Business
When pages fail, conversions stop and customer confidence drops fast. That loss is measurable: research shows more than 9% of visitors will not return after encountering a broken site. A short outage can turn curious users into lost opportunities.
The Cost of Downtime
Every minute offline costs revenue and damages trust. Teams that track status and performance with active checks catch issues early.
Investing in reliable monitoring reduces incident time and gives your team precise data to act. Proper plans and pricing affect how fast you scale response and recover.
Protecting Your Brand Reputation
Consistent service status matters in a competitive market. Users expect pages to load and transactions to work.
- Reliable platform alerts you before customers notice.
- Comprehensive checks help you prevent repeat incidents.
- Clear status pages and support preserve trust during outages.
Understanding the Core Components of Website Monitoring
Track core signals like HTTP responses, TCP handshakes, and SSL expiry to protect service quality.
Modern monitoring covers availability, performance, and security. You should test key endpoints and critical pages so users see consistent service.
Make sure your platform supports HTTP, TCP, and SSL checks. These checks reveal different failure modes and reduce blind spots for your team.
Use historical data to spot trends in response times and error rates. Pair that analysis with the right pricing plan so small businesses and enterprises avoid overspending.
Communicate incidents with a clear status page. Synthetic checks and real user data give complementary views: one simulates flows, the other measures real experience.
| Check Type | What It Measures | Suggested Frequency | Why It Matters |
|---|---|---|---|
| HTTP | Response codes and page content | 30–60s | Detects broken pages and content regressions |
| TCP | Port reachability and handshake time | 1–5m | Surfaces network or service process failures |
| SSL | Certificate validity and chain | Daily | Prevents expired certs and trust errors for users |
| Real User | Load times and browser errors | Continuous | Shows actual user experience across pages |
For deeper analytics, consider integrating with analytics plugins to combine synthetic checks and real user metrics into one dashboard.
Top Picks for the Best Website Uptime Monitoring Tools
We vetted 28 services to surface options that combine synthetic checks with real user data. Our selection highlights platforms that give precise alerts, intuitive status pages, and global location coverage.
Each entry was judged on API and transaction checks, browser testing, and reporting depth. We tested multiple plans to measure value per month and how each platform minimizes false positives during an incident.
For teams that need full coverage, look for a monitoring tool that supports both synthetic monitoring and real user monitoring. Integrations matter — choose platforms that connect with your incident stack, support detailed reporting, and run tests from many locations.
- Accurate alerts: reduces noise so your team acts on real incidents.
- Transaction and API checks: verify critical user flows and pages.
- Pricing transparency: monthly plans matched to team size and traffic.
Evaluating Uptime.com for Comprehensive Performance Data
Uptime.com surfaces granular performance signals so you can resolve API and page failures quickly. The platform blends synthetic tests with real user monitoring to give teams both simulated and actual session views.
Advanced API and Transaction Checks
API coverage includes REST, gRPC, and GraphQL. That means you can track API latency and error rates across endpoints.
Transaction checks let you replicate key flows like add-to-cart or login without code. Those scripted journeys run from multiple locations to catch regional regressions.
- Over 30 types of checks, from SSL to complex API calls.
- RUM data from 1.5M page views provides real user insight into page load and errors.
- Customizable status pages keep your users informed during any incident.
| Capability | What it shows | Why it matters |
|---|---|---|
| API (REST/gRPC/GraphQL) | Latency, error codes, traces | Find integration faults before customers do |
| Transaction checks | End-to-end success rates | Validate critical user journeys without code |
| RUM & browser | Real user timings from 1.5M views | Prioritize fixes that improve user experience |
Pricing starts at $20 per month and scales with your chosen plan. The platform supports global locations, integrations with incident systems, and responsive support for your team.
Leveraging Datadog for Real User Monitoring and Analytics
Session replays and RUM data make hidden user issues visible in Datadog. The platform turns raw sessions into video-like replays so your team can reproduce errors and low engagement quickly.
Datadog packs 800+ integrations, so you can push events into Slack, PagerDuty, or your incident stack. It tracks Core Web Vitals and browser metrics to guide performance fixes that improve conversions.
The platform supports synthetic monitoring and API testing alongside real user monitoring. That blend helps you compare scripted checks with actual sessions to find regressions fast.
- Affordable RUM: $1.80 per month for 1,000 sessions makes testing scalable for growth.
- Actionable replays: See click paths, errors, and slow resources in context.
- Status pages & alerts: Built-in features help you manage incident communication and response.
Use Datadog to analyze page-level data, prioritize fixes, and validate changes with browser testing. The result: clearer reports, faster root-cause work, and a team that resolves user-facing issues with confidence.
Why UptimeRobot Remains a Top Choice for Budget-Conscious Teams
UptimeRobot gives small teams the coverage they need without straining a tight budget. The platform starts with 50 free monitors, so you can cover critical pages and endpoints right away.
For teams on a budget, paid plans unlock more frequent checks and added features from just $7 per month. That price makes it easy to add synthetic monitoring for HTTP, port, and ping checks without heavy overhead.
UptimeRobot also sends keyword alerts and checks for ssl certificate and domain expiry. Those safeguards prevent the common slip of expired credentials and lost trust.
- 50 free monitors to start monitoring your site fast.
- Synthetic checks for HTTP, port, and ping to protect performance.
- Customizable status pages and simple integrations so your team receives instant alerts during an incident.
- Keyword alerts, ssl domain tracking, and affordable pricing make this monitoring tool ideal for small business teams.
Set up takes minutes, and the clear UI helps you scale checks as your team grows. UptimeRobot balances cost and coverage so you can focus on users and uptime without a complex platform.
Scaling Infrastructure with Pingdom for Large Enterprises
Scaling complex infrastructure demands precise data, fast root cause signals, and transparent status updates.
Pingdom is a powerful platform aimed at enterprises that must monitor thousands of endpoints and serve millions of users. Its plans include 22 configurable options and usage-based pricing that ranges from $10 to $18,300 per month.
Use Pingdom to combine synthetic monitoring with real user monitoring so you see both scripted checks and actual session data. That dual view reduces blind spots and helps your team act on verified incidents.
Root Cause Analysis
Pinpoint failures quickly. Pingdom links checks, transactions, and API responses to give root cause context. Your team can trace errors to a specific service, region, or code path.
For enterprise SLAs, the platform offers detailed reporting suitable for stakeholders and audits. It supports up to 30,000 monitors and 1,500 sms alerts for critical notifications.
Element-Wise Speed Testing
Pingdom breaks page load into components. The element-wise speed testing shows which CSS, HTML, or JavaScript files slow a page.
Use those findings to prioritize fixes that improve performance for real users. Advanced status pages keep your users informed during any incident and reduce inbound support load.
| Feature | Why it matters | Enterprise limits |
|---|---|---|
| Element-wise speed testing | Identifies slow assets for targeted fixes | Full page breakdowns per check |
| Root cause traces | Maps failures to services and teams | Cross-checks with transaction and api data |
| RUM & synthetic checks | Combines scripted tests with real user insight | Support for global locations and browser testing |
| Status pages & reporting | Maintains transparency and proves SLA compliance | Custom pages, downloadable reports |
Utilizing Site24x7 for Versatile Network and Server Tracking
Site24x7 centralizes checks for servers, networks, and pages so you see problems before they escalate.
The platform bundles website checks, server health, and network tracing in one console. It also includes 100 free utilities—think SLA uptime calculators and ssl certificate checks—that help small teams get started fast.
Use the no-code recorder to create transaction flows. You can validate API endpoints with JSONPath or XPath assertions. That makes it simple to test complex integrations without scripting.
- Comprehensive coverage: network tracking on all plans keeps your entire stack visible.
- Defacement alerts: baseline DOM comparison spots unauthorized page changes quickly.
- Pro plan: $35 per month gives 40 basic monitors and 500k RUM page views.
- Clear status pages: keep users informed with public health pages and incident data.
Detailed reporting surfaces performance bottlenecks and regional regressions across locations. For expanded analytics, pair Site24x7 with an advanced rank tracker to tie operational data to visibility metrics.
Exploring Alternative Solutions for Specialized Monitoring Needs

If vendor control matters, open-source options let you own checks, alerts, and status pages.
Open Source Options for Self-Hosted Environments
Uptime Kuma and similar projects provide HTTP, TCP, and DNS checks without license fees. You can script transaction checks and build custom alert flows that match your team.
These solutions keep your data inside your private network. That reduces third-party exposure and avoids vendor lock-in.
- Custom status pages: brand and host them on your domain.
- Flexible alerts: webhook, email, or on-prem integrations.
- Cost control: no monthly license, but plan for hosting and maintenance.
| Aspect | Open-Source | Commercial |
|---|---|---|
| Cost | No monthly license; hosting costs only | Subscription pricing and tiers |
| Control | Full control over data and status pages | Managed data, limited customization |
| Features | Core checks and integrations; extensible | Advanced analytics, RUM, and support |
Open-source stacks suit teams that want full control and customizable workflows. They scale well with automation, but expect higher setup and upkeep effort compared with managed platforms.
Critical Criteria for Selecting Your Monitoring Platform
Start by mapping which services and pages you must protect. List critical user journeys such as login, checkout, and API endpoints. Match each path to the type of checks you need — synthetic monitoring for scripted flows and real user data for live experience.
Look for global locations so users across regions see consistent performance. Ensure the platform supports ssl domain checks and browser testing to catch certificate or rendering failures early.
Prioritize clear reporting and scalable plans. Detailed analytics and exportable data help teams make fast, data-driven fixes. Choose a pricing model that scales with your growth and avoids surprise costs per month.
Public status pages preserve user trust during incidents. Finally, test support channels — fast, knowledgeable responses matter when complex issues arise. For a deeper comparison of features and plans, see this review: monitoring platform guide.
Common Pitfalls That Lead to Inaccurate Alerting
When every notification screams urgency, teams stop trusting the signal. Alert fatigue is the most common pitfall. You get too many low-value alerts and your responders start to ignore them.
False positives make this worse. Unrealistic thresholds and single-location checks trigger needless pages. Use verification steps to confirm failures before sending critical alerts.
Avoiding Alert Fatigue
Set realistic thresholds based on historical data. Group related checks so one incident creates one clear alert.
Use escalation rules and on-call rotation to reduce noise. Review alert volume each month and tune rules that generate repeat false positives.
Managing Third-Party Dependencies
Third-party services can fail and look like your fault. Track external APIs, payment gateways, and analytics scripts as separate checks.
Keep a dependency map and add synthetic monitoring and real user sampling for critical flows. That combo shows whether failures are internal or caused by a vendor.
- Customize alerts: tie notifications to specific user journeys and priorities.
- Verify failures: use automatic retry and multi-location checks to avoid false positives.
- Status pages should reflect verified incidents only to keep users informed without confusion.
| Pitfall | Quick fix | Why it works |
|---|---|---|
| Alert fatigue | Consolidate alerts; adjust thresholds | Reduces noise and restores trust |
| False positives | Verify failures with secondary checks | Prevents unnecessary escalations |
| Third-party failures | Monitor vendor endpoints and map dependencies | Clarifies root cause and speeds resolution |
Finally, review your configuration regularly and tie incident notes to performance data. For help with analytics integrations and a common GA4 tag issue, see this GA4 tag tracking fix.
Integrating Monitoring with Incident Management Workflows

Turn passive signals into immediate action by wiring your checks to automated incident flows. When an alert fires, it should reach the right person without delay. Route notifications based on on-call schedules so Mondays at 3 a.m. go to the night engineer automatically.
Include context in every alert. Links to logs, runbooks, and recent deploys cut mean time to acknowledge and resolve. Use escalation policies so missed pages escalate to the next responder.
Tools like OnPage let you elevate critical alerts so they bypass silent modes and reach responders directly. Centralize notifications to reduce tool sprawl and keep incident data in one place.
Automate status pages updates when incidents are verified. That keeps customers informed without manual edits and prevents duplicated status work across teams.
- Route alerts: tie checks to the right on-call rota.
- Enrich context: attach logs, dashboards, and docs to notifications.
- Escalate automatically: fallback rules preserve response speed.
- Sync status pages: update public pages when incidents change state.
| Need | How to implement | Outcome |
|---|---|---|
| Correct routing | Integrate with on-call schedule (calendar or SSO) | Faster first response |
| Actionable alerts | Add links to logs, traces, and runbooks | Reduced resolution time |
| Escalation | Automated policies and retries | Reliable coverage across shifts |
| Public communication | Auto-update status pages from incident API | Clear, consistent user updates |
Balancing Synthetic Testing and Real User Data
A balanced approach that pairs scripted tests with live session data gives you a clearer picture of site health.
Use synthetic monitoring to run repeatable checks on critical flows like login and checkout. These scripted tests catch regressions in APIs and surface timing issues before they reach users.
Real user monitoring collects performance and error data from actual visitors. It shows device-, browser-, and network-specific problems that lab tests might miss.
- Run scheduled synthetic checks for end-to-end paths every month or as your release cadence requires.
- Capture RUM data to spot regional or device-based regressions in pages and scripts.
- Set paired alerts so both synthetic failures and real user spikes trigger incident workflows.
Combine both sources to prioritize fixes that improve measurable performance and user experience. For related security notifications and identity hygiene, consider a guide to password managers with dark web monitoring as part of your incident playbook.
Future-Proofing Your Digital Infrastructure
,Plan for growth by choosing systems that scale with traffic and complex user journeys.
Invest in both real user monitoring and synthetic monitoring to catch regressions before they affect conversions. Run frequent checks and tune alerts so your team acts on verified incidents.
Keep public status pages current and automate updates to preserve trust during outages. Pick a flexible platform with clear pricing and layered features so costs scale per month with usage.
Review configuration regularly and align checks to critical pages and user flows. For a practical comparison of monitoring options, see this guide: monitoring tools for IT.



